Bashundhara Kings defeated Rahmatgonj 1-0 in their Bangladesh Premier League football match at their home ground in Nilphamari on Thursday to remain top of the table with 15 points.
Abahani also have 15 points but are placed second as a result of goal difference.
The first half of the match remained goalless even though Bashundhara had chances to take the lead, but failed to finish.
In the second half, the wave of attacks from the home team continued and in the 50th minute Marcus Vinicious was fouled in the d-box by Rahmatgonj defender Monday Osaji as the referee blew his whistle to give Bashundhara a penalty.
It was up to Baktyiar Deshobikov to convert the penalty and give his side the lead as Bashundhara held on to the one goal advantage and grab all three points.

However, the Kings’ manager Jobayer Nipu was hoping for more goals while also expressing his displeasure about the refereeing: “We could have won by more goals but Rahmatgonj played very well defensively. Also, the referee didn’t give us two clear penalties.”
On the other hand, Rahmatgonj coach Syed Golam Jilani also expressed his qualms about the officiating: “The penalty decision that went against us was incorrect. How will we be able to get points with such officiating? But yes, we did get chances to score but we failed to grab the opportunity.”
In the other game, Nofel Sporting Club and BJMC played out a goalless draw at the Shahid Bulu Stadium in Noakhali. After six games, Nofel and BJMC both have two points with BJMC having played one more match.
